KENT IS ONE OF THE MOST OUTSTANDING COUNTIES IN THE ENTIRE COUNTRY WHERE EDUCATION IS CONCERNED – AND THAT ’ S OFFICIAL . 2021 OFSTED FIGURES SHOW THAT OVER 90 PRIMARY SCHOOLS AND MORE THAN 30 SECONDARY SCHOOLS IN KENT HAVE BEEN RANKED OUTSTANDING BY OFSTED INSPECTORS , WHICH IS PRETTY INCREDIBLE CONSIDERING ALL OF THE DISRUPTIONS THAT THE PAST TWO YEARS HAVE BROUGHT TO THE LIVES OF BOTH PUPILS AND TEACHERS .
